Active compound composition of the present invention, is by weight the following raw material of proportioning: the Poria of 1 ~ 90%, the Ganoderma of 1 ~ 90%, the Herba Dendrobii of 1 ~ 90% and the macro fungi of surplus are obtained through extracting.
Described raw material weight matches well than being the Poria of 1 ~ 60%, the Ganoderma of 1 ~ 60%, the Herba Dendrobii of 1 ~ 60% and the macro fungi of surplus.
Described raw material weight matches well than being the Poria of 1 ~ 30%, the Ganoderma of 1 ~ 30%, the Herba Dendrobii of 1 ~ 30% and the macro fungi of surplus.
Described active compound composition is that raw material obtains through pulverizing, extraction, drying, mixture.
The described one be extracted as in water extraction or alcohol extraction.
Described macro fungi is one or more in Lentinus Edodes and Volvariella volvacea (Bull.Ex Franch.) Singer., Flammulina velutiper (Fr.) Sing, Agaricus bisporus, Pleurotus ostreatus, Auricularia, Tremella, Caulis Bambusae In Taeniam, Gaster caprae seu Ovis.
The preparation method of active compound composition of the present invention, it is characterized in that comprising get the raw materials ready, extract, concentrate drying, testing sequence, specifically comprise:
A, to get the raw materials ready: cross the raw material after 10 mesh sieves by weight weighing by through screening, coarse pulverization;
B, extraction: the purified water adding weight ratio 2 ~ 6 times in raw material Poria, reflux, extract, 3 ~ 5 times, each 2 ~ 3h, merge extractive liquid, filter, under agitation add ethanol, make alcohol content reach 70 ~ 80%, leave standstill 12 ~ 24h, separate out precipitation, filter, collecting precipitation thing obtains Poria extract; Add 80 ~ 99% ethanol of 2 ~ 5 times in raw material Ganoderma, hot bath backflow 3 ~ 5 times, each 2 ~ 3h, merge extractive liquid, reclaims ethanol, filters to get filtrate, and concentrates to obtain Ganoderma extract; 90 ~ 95 DEG C of purified water lixiviates 1 ~ 3 time of weight ratio 1 ~ 10 times of raw material Herba Dendrobii, each 3 ~ 4h, merges lixiviating solution, filters, and concentratedly to obtain Herba Dendrobii extract; 95 ~ 100 DEG C of purified water lixiviates 2 ~ 3 times of weight ratio 1 ~ 20 times of raw material macro fungi, each 2 ~ 3h, merges lixiviating solution, filters, and concentratedly to obtain macro fungi extract;
C, drying and crushing: each extract is carried out respectively be dried to moisture content 1 ~ 9%, cross 10 mesh sieves through coarse pulverization;
D, mixture: mixed by each extract after coarse pulverization, obtained objective composition through pulverizing 80 mesh sieves;
E, inspection: objective composition is carried out sterilizing subpackage, pick test, provide inspection report.
Described concentration of alcohol is 90 ~ 99%.
Described recovery ethanol is reclaimed by thermal evaporation or embrane method recovery.
Described is filtered into membrane filtration, and filter sizes is 0.2 ~ 15 mm.
Described drying is constant pressure and dry or drying under reduced pressure, takes one or more the combination in spraying dry, lyophilization, microwave drying, forced air drying, hygroscopic desiccation.

2.2 active compound compositions are on the impact of immunologic hypofunction mice serum hemolysin level
Choose healthy Kunming mouse 60, be divided into 6 groups at random, be respectively active compound composition 1.04,0.52,
0.26g/kg dosage group and Ganoderma 5.2mg/kg group, model group (giving cyclophosphamide) and blank group.Each group of successive administration, in administration the 5th day, to every Mus lumbar injection 5% chicken erythrocyte suspension 0.2ml.Except blank group, all the other each group, respectively at the 4th day, the 9th day, by 75mg/kg dosage intraperitoneal injection of cyclophosphamide, is caused immunologic hypofunction model.Successive administration 10d, tests on the 11st day.Each group of mice eyeground vein clump gets blood, centrifugalize serum, with normal saline by serum-dilution 50 times, get dilute serum 1ml to add in reaction tube, then add 0.5% chicken erythrocyte suspension 0.5ml, in frozen water, then add 0.5ml complement (10%3 Cavia porcellus pooled serums), solution in reaction tube is shaken up, be placed in 37 DEG C of waters bath with thermostatic control and react 30min, jolting 2 times in course of reaction, after reaction terminates, reaction tube is placed in 0 DEG C of refrigerator cessation reaction.Centrifugal, get supernatant in 722 type spectrophotometer 540nm place colorimetrics, measure absorbance (adjusting 0 with the blank pipe not adding mice serum), represent the height of mice serum hemolysin level with the absorbance of supernatant.Each group of result Excel software carries out statistical procedures.Result shows, and model group mice serum hemolysin level comparatively blank group significantly reduces; Compare with model group, active compound composition group 1.04,0.52g/kg can significantly improve the serum hemolysin of mice, improve the inhibitory action that cyclophosphamide produces mice serum hemolysin level.In table 2.
